Epinephrine metabolites and pigmentation in the central nervous system in a case of phenylpyruvic oligophrenia.

The biochemical lesion associated with mental deficiency in phenylpyruvic oligophrenia is a failure of an enzyme system in these individuals to hydroxylate phenylalanine to tyrosine (Jervis, 1953).
